## Session handling during the Coalbin queue migration

As we replace the homegrown Coalbin queue with Ferrostream, workers must carry a session through both systems during the cutover window. The shim mints one session at startup and renews it every hour; dual-enqueue depends on it staying valid. The shim authenticates to Ferrostream with the bearer token below.

login token, bagug-kafop: eyJhbGciOiJIUzI1NiIsInR5cCI6IkpXVCJ9.eyJzdWIiOiIcMLov2In0.Z5RLDIfp

Subject: Pricing experiment cut-over — done!

Hi all — quick recap for the newer folks. We finished the cut-over of the Gatewick ticket-pricing experiment last night. All traffic now flows through the Fairebox variant engine, and the old static price table is retired. Rollback stays available for two weeks, then we delete it. No anomalies so far; conversion metrics look steady. The live configuration after the cut-over is below.

deployment values, yadug-bawif:
[framir]
team = pelox
access_code = ac_a38ab2
owner = tamion.julael
host = framir.tolvaqlabs.test
port = 11211
peer = tammir.zemvargrid.local
salt = 2215ef03
pin = 1541

Onboarding — Retry safety in the Paylark plugin API

Every payment retry your plugin issues must reuse the original idempotency key, so duplicate charges are impossible even under network flaps. Retried requests are also signature-checked against our gateway, meaning your submission pipeline needs the current signer configured. Add the signing key below to your plugin's release settings.

release key, hadug-kawef: bky13_mPGeFZeR1GZ1G

**Q: Why does Graphlace show stale edges after a release cut?**

Graphlace rebuilds its dependency graph from the Merrowick artifact index, which refreshes on a thirty-minute schedule. If you cut a release immediately after merging manifest changes, the visualizer may still render edges from the previous snapshot. This is expected; forcing a rebuild mid-cycle is unnecessary and can double-count transitive nodes. The refresh schedule and manual rebuild procedure for release managers are documented on the internal page below.

operations page: https://jira.qorvelsys.internal/browse/pages/browse/pages